The construction of the three residences was presented as being similar, with all <br /> structures to be built on concrete slabs with concrete support walls at first floor and the <br /> remainder of the construction to be standard wood framing with metal roofing. Height at roof <br /> midpoints will be approximately thirty-five (35)feet and will not exceed a maximum of forty- <br /> five(45)feet. <br /> 20. The Applicant's design included parcel setbacks of twenty (20)feet for the front <br /> and rear setbacks and twelve (12) feet for the side setbacks as required for three stories. <br /> 21. The Applicant proposed a separate septic system on each parcel for each <br /> residence to be installed as approved by the Department of Health. <br /> 22. County water is available to the site for potable water use. <br /> C. DESCRIPTION OF PROPERTY AND SURROUNDING AREAS <br /> 23. Subject Property: The three (3) subject parcels are located at the end of Machida <br /> Lane, and total approximately 24,250 square feet in size. They are generally flat and overgrown <br /> with primarily non-native trees and grasses as was determined via previous Special Management <br /> Area approval for land clearing. <br /> 24. Parcel 44, located on the makai side of Machida Lane, borders Onekahakaha <br /> Beach Park. <br /> 25. Parcels 45 and 46 are mauka of Parcel 44 and are approximately three hundred <br /> and eighty (380) feet from the shoreline. <br /> 26.
